Active ingredients and Variations
A trademark of Mexican food, mole showcases a rich tapestry of ingredients and local variations that reflect the nation's varied culinary landscape. Generally, mole combines a selection of chiles, seasonings, nuts, seeds, and delicious chocolate, producing an intricate taste account. One of the most popular variation, mole poblano, hails from Puebla and features ingredients like ancho and pasilla chiles, almonds, and dark delicious chocolate. Various other local selections, such as mole negro from Oaxaca, stress different seasonings and techniques, resulting in unique preferences and structures. Some moles might include fruits, herbs, or even local specializeds, better enhancing their uniqueness. This versatility enables mole to be a functional accompaniment for numerous recipes, specifically meats, showcasing the deepness and splendor of Mexican cooking traditions.

Ceviche: Quality From the Sea
Ceviche, celebrated for its stimulating qualities and vibrant flavors, stands as a demo of the bounty of the sea in Mexican cuisine. This meal usually includes fresh fish or seafood, marinaded in citrus juices, mainly lime, which successfully "cooks" the protein while instilling it with a vibrant brightness. Commonly integrated with active ingredients such as chopped onions, tomatoes, cilantro, and chili peppers, ceviche provides a harmonious mix of structures and tastes that record the significance of coastal living.
Areas throughout Mexico have their very own variants, showcasing regional seafood and unique flavor mixes. As an example, in the Yucatán Peninsula, ceviche is often coupled with avocado and skilled with a tip of orange juice for a tropical twist. Offered cooled, this meal is not just a favorite appetiser however additionally a renewing alternative on warm days, personifying the spirit of celebration and community located in Mexican culinary practices.

These stuffed peppers are commonly made with poblano or Anaheim peppers, which are meticulously baked to enhance their flavor and aroma. Once peeled, the peppers are full of a full-flavored combination, frequently consisting of cheese, meat, or beans, developing a delightful collection of tastes and textures
After being packed, the chiles are generally dipped in a light batter and fried up until golden brown, including a gratifying crisis. They are typically offered with a rich tomato sauce or salsa, additional elevating their taste account.
